Hawkeye coloring pages offer a dynamic gateway into the world of Marvel Comics, allowing artists of all ages to bring the skilled archer’s iconic presence to life. These printable sheets capture the essence of Clint Barton, transforming his signature blue and black costume into a canvas for creative expression. By engaging with these specific designs, users connect directly with one of the Avengers' most relatable figures, exploring themes of precision, loyalty, and redemption through color.


The resurgence in popularity of superhero coloring pages speaks to a blend of nostalgia and modern mindfulness. Unlike generic characters, Hawkeye provides a unique drawing challenge with his intricate costume details and intense facial expressions. This complexity transforms a simple activity into an engaging puzzle, where children and adults alike must consider shading techniques to highlight the texture of his leather gear and the flex of his muscles. The act of focusing on these minute color choices serves as a form of active meditation, promoting concentration and fine motor skill development.

When selecting the perfect sheet, look for designs that vary in complexity to match the user's age and skill level. Some pages feature Hawkeye in a dynamic shooting stance, requiring careful planning for color gradients across his tights and recurve bow. Others might present him in a reflective pose, offering larger, more open spaces ideal for younger children or those practicing color theory. The specific palette used is crucial; encouraging kids to deviate from the standard blue and black allows them to experiment with alternative identities for the character, fostering imaginative storytelling.

Beyond entertainment, these coloring sheets provide significant educational value. Children learning to stay within the lines are practicing hand-eye coordination and control, which are precursors to writing proficiency. Furthermore, deciding on a color scheme—whether to stick to the comic book realism or invent a new palette—engages cognitive processes related to decision-making and problem-solving. Hawkeye’s relatively human appearance, devoid of overwhelming fantasy elements, makes him an excellent subject for discussing realistic color palettes and anatomy in a fun, low-stakes environment.

| Complexity Level | Recommended Age Group | Learning Focus |
|---|---|---|
| Simple (Bold Lines) | 3-5 Years | Color Recognition, Grip Control |
| Moderate (Detail) | 6-8 Years | Shading, Pattern Integration |
| Advanced (Intricate) | 9+ Years | Realism, Texture Application |
